Working Principle of Pneumatic Conveying Systems

The core mechanism of pneumatic conveying involves the use of air to transport bulk materials through a pipeline system. The process typically operates under negative pressure (suction) or positive pressure (blowing). In negative pressure systems, a vacuum is created at the material inlet, drawing the material into the pipeline as air flows through. Positive pressure systems, on the other hand, use compressed air to push the material through the system. Both methods rely on the interaction between air flow and material particles to achieve efficient transport.

Key components of the system include the material hopper, which stores the auxiliary materials; the airlock or feeder, which controls the flow of material into the pipeline; the conveying line, which transports the material; and the receiver or discharge hopper, where the material is collected. The system is powered by a blower or fan, which generates the necessary air pressure or vacuum. The design of these components is optimized to minimize material degradation, prevent blockages, and ensure smooth operation.

One notable feature is the ability to handle a wide range of material types and particle sizes, from fine powders to coarse granules. This versatility makes it suitable for transporting limestone, gypsum, and other auxiliary materials commonly used in cement production.

Another important feature is the system's ability to maintain a clean and dust-free environment. Pneumatic conveying minimizes dust generation compared to traditional mechanical systems, reducing the risk of contamination and improving workplace safety. The equipment also incorporates advanced control systems that allow for precise regulation of material flow rates and air pressure, ensuring consistent and reliable operation.

Advantages in Cement Production

The adoption of pneumatic conveying equipment for cement auxiliary materials offers several significant advantages. Firstly, it improves operational efficiency by enabling continuous and automated material transport, reducing downtime and labor costs. The system's ability to handle large volumes of material in a compact footprint also optimizes space utilization in production facilities.

Secondly, it enhances product quality by ensuring consistent material handling. The controlled environment and precise flow regulation prevent material degradation and contamination, which can affect the final properties of the cement. This consistency is critical for meeting quality standards and customer expectations.
